Like I mentioned in the previous email. you can donate him something within your capacity as a token of appreciation. Yes, GPL(v3) does allow you to charge whatever you want. However, you can also get the source code and do whatever you want as long as you follow the GPL (v3). The developer cannot force you to pay rather than obtaining the source code and compile it yourself (ask your friend(s) to compile). But again, I would stress that developers spend their valuable time on developing/maintaining those resources, and we should honour their work and provide some compensation.
